The Application Process

Acquiring a driving license in Switzerland involves several actions which can vary based on the applicant's age and the type of lorry they wish to run. Below are the general steps associated with acquiring a Swiss driving license:

Meet Eligibility Requirements

  • Guarantee you satisfy the minimum age and residency requirements.

Total a First Aid Course

  • Registering in a first-aid course is obligatory before beginning driving lessons.

Pass the Vision Test

  • A vision test must be finished to guarantee you satisfy the visual skill essential for driving.

Enroll in a Driving School

  • Select a recognized driving school to begin your theoretical and practical lessons.

Pass the Theoretical Exam

  • After finishing your lessons, you need to pass a theoretical test that covers traffic laws, indications, and safe driving practices.

Arrange Practical Driving Exam

  • After passing the theoretical examination and completing a set number of driving hours, you can look for the useful driving test.

Receive Your Driving License

  • Upon successful conclusion of the dry run, you will receive your Swiss driving license.

Exchange of Foreign Driving Licenses

For individuals transferring to Switzerland, exchanging a foreign driving license for a Swiss one can considerably streamline the transition. The following describes the process and requirements for exchanging a foreign driving license:

CountryExchange AllowedTesting Requirements
EU/EFTA countriesYesNo extra tests needed
Non-EU/EFTA nationsLimitedTheoretical and useful tests might be needed
